Does anyone have any contact info for the  demon.net pgp keyserver?
It's mx'd to a couple of addresses, and one of them
bounces every update when it happens to get involved, like
so:

[email protected]

The original message was received at Wed, 03 Aug 2005 15:26:34 -0700

  ----- The following addresses had permanent fatal errors -----
<[email protected]>

  ----- Transcript of session follows -----
... while talking to relay-1.mail.demon.net
>>> RCPT To:<[email protected]>
<<< 550 relay not permitted
--------

I've not been able to raise anyone at demon.net to deal with this.

I assume it's either some kind of daft spam control.

BTW, this happens periodically with lots of key servers - 
watch your MX backup servers, your local mail rules and anti-spam
measures might knock out your pgp key server incremental service.
